AceShowbiz - Cardi B has firmly denied claims that she buys luxury bags for herself while pretending her estranged husband is the one gifting them, amidst his escalating financial and legal problems.
The Bronx-born rapper responded to social media speculation after a video surfaced showing her opening a Birkin bag and dancing, making it clear she is “never the type to do lame s### like that.” Cardi B further emphasized, “There was no money problems when I was regulating,” highlighting her own financial stability despite Offset’s difficulties.
Offset, the former Migos member and Cardi B’s ex-husband, has been struggling with serious financial troubles since their split in 2023. He currently faces more than $2.3 million in combined IRS and Georgia state tax liens. Although he managed to pay off $1.57 million of that debt in late 2025, his financial challenges continue to mount.
Adding to his woes, just days before being shot outside the Seminole Hard Rock Hotel and Casino in Hollywood, Florida, on April 6, Offset was hit with a $100,000 lawsuit from MotorCity Casino Hotel in Detroit. The casino alleges he opened a credit line in March 2024 to gamble but failed to pay the debt when they attempted to withdraw funds from his bank account. His attorney states he is “working toward a resolution,” but this represents only one of many ongoing issues.

Meanwhile, former NFL player Dez Bryant and radio personality Ebro Darden have publicly accused Offset of owing them thousands of dollars in unpaid bets. Although he has been discharged from the hospital and is reportedly recovering, his legal and financial problems are far from resolved.
In stark contrast, Cardi B has been steadily expanding her business empire. Her Whipshots vodka-infused whipped cream has sold over six million cans since its 2022 launch, and she has diversified into other ventures like Grown Good. By 2025, her estimated net worth reached $100 million, and her ongoing “Little Miss Drama” tour has generated over $33 million in revenue.
